A small minotaur, his Mum Medusa, a Cyclops delivery guy, the neighbors the Grey Sisters... Legendary characters from the Greek mythology live their lives and solve their problems in today's world.
2013
1989
1965
2017
1995
2015
2012
1953
2011
2002
2009
2000
1937
2014
1992